Vector Fields and Flows

Vector Fields and Their Flows

Vector fields are one of the most intuitive geometric objects we can study on manifolds. They assign a tangent vector to each point of the manifold, giving us a way to describe motion and change across the entire space.

The Power of Vector Fields

Vector fields appear naturally in many contexts:

  • As the velocity field of a fluid
  • As the gradient of a function
  • As generators of symmetries
  • As solutions to differential equations
